Putian provides opportunities for cultural immersion through workshops, performances, and festivals.
On Meizhou Island, especially during Mazu festivals, you can witness traditional performances related to Mazu worship.
A traditional local opera form. Performances are rare and mainly in the local dialect, offering an authentic glimpse into local performing arts.
These include the Mazu Cultural Festival and Putian Litchi Festival, offering seasonal and celebratory dishes and events.
Celebrated annually on Meizhou Island (Mazu's birthday, typically April/May). Features grand parades, temple rituals, and performances, drawing pilgrims and visitors.
Celebrates the seasonal litchi harvest, typically held in June-July. This event offers a chance to enjoy fresh litchis and local festivities.
Visit Xiantou Wood Carving Village or Putian Expo Park for demonstrations and purchases of intricate wood, stone, and jade crafts.

Putian has diverse shopping experiences, from old-fashioned markets to modern malls and artisan workshops.
Mazu-related charms and figurines from Meizhou Island, intricate wood carvings from Xiantou, local Oolong teas (like Tieguanyin), plus seasonal variations Putian Litchi products (dried litchi or litchi wine).
Large shopping malls in the city center, like Wanda Plaza, offer international and domestic brands, presenting a modern shopping experience.
